# Onboarding: Health Checks Behind the Balancer

All Copperline app nodes sit behind the Wrenfield balancer. Health checks hit /healthz every 10s; two consecutive failures drain the node. If you see a node flapping, check the probe logs before restarting anything — most flaps are slow dependency calls, not dead processes. Probe queries against the internal status service require auth. The key the probe agent uses is below.

gateway credential: kto23_dolYgAScEh2TaPOlStqOl98

## Authentication and Rate Limiting

All requests through the Veltrix gateway are rate limited per key, not per host, so please do not share credentials between services. The default ceiling is 120 requests per minute; exceeding it returns a 429 with a retry-after header you should honor exactly. For local testing against the staging gateway, use the key below.

API key for kahop-bagef: zpat2_yb

The garage occupancy feed for the Brindlewood campus arrives over a message queue every thirty seconds, one record per level, published by the Stallgrid edge boxes. Counts can briefly go negative when a sensor double-fires on exit; the ingest job clamps these to zero and flags the interval. If the feed stalls for more than five minutes, the dashboard falls back to the last known snapshot. Sensor mappings, queue names, and the replay procedure are documented on the internal page below.

runbook for tahog-kadug: https://gitlab.qirvanworks.corp/projects/pages/view/b139298aed28

- [ ] Spreadsheet export memory check (Gridfall). Large workbook exports previously peaked at 6 GB per worker; streaming writer should cap this near 800 MB. Run the 500k-row fixture, confirm RSS stays under the cap, and note results in the sync doc. Sign-off requires recording the build token, which appears below.

session token of tajef-bageg = htk21_5d90d574934f3ccae6437

## Tuning: health checks

The Corbelline load balancer probes each replica of the ledger service and ejects nodes after consecutive failures. Last sync we agreed the defaults were too twitchy during deploys, causing false ejections and cascading restarts. The interval, timeout, and failure threshold now live in one config stanza so we can tune them together. Current values, as shipped in release 14, are below.

constants for bagaf-hadup:
QUOTAS = {
    "quenael": 1,
    "ralwyn": 1,
    "oliath": 2,
    "ulaael": 2,
}